# Renderbarn transcode farm — env for worker nodes.
# Heads up for security review: workers pull jobs from the Quillet queue
# and push outputs to cold storage. Nothing here should be world-readable;
# the file is templated per-node at boot. Queue auth is the only secret
# in this file. The queue credential goes on the line directly after this comment.

vault entry, yahaf-tagug: LEDGER_TOKEN20=884d77d1a8b98aa4edfb

Ticket: staging env misconfigured for Lattice-UI consumers. New folks: our shared component library (Lattice-UI) is versioned per-channel, and staging was pinned to the "dawn" channel instead of "stable", so half the Pellbrook dashboard rendered with unreleased button styles. Fix is to set LATTICE_CHANNEL=stable in .env.staging and redeploy. Note the registry that serves pinned channel builds is private, so the env file also needs the registry access entry, which goes on the very next line.

vault entry, yahif-yajep: COURIER_KEY29=b802bdf8034096b65a51c6ba5abe2

Ticket: RNDR-4471 — Config drift on template rendering nodes

Hey on-call — heads up that the Plumeria render fleet has drifted again. Nodes in the eastern pool are running with a bigger partial cache and a different precompile flag than what's in the repo, which is why render p95 looks suspiciously great there and terrible everywhere else. Please don't hand-edit further; we'll reconcile via the deploy pipeline tomorrow. For reference, here's what the drifted nodes are actually running with.

service settings:
PRAIX_LOG_LEVEL=error
PRAIX_METRICS_HOST=metrics.praix.qorvelcorp.corp
PRAIX_POOL_SIZE=16

Quarterly Planning Note — Board of Veltrana Systems

Requesting 1.4M for Q3. Breakdown: 600K tooling upgrades at the Ostermill plant, 450K for the Lanternfish platform rebuild, 350K contingency tied to the Drayle contract renewal. Prior quarter spend came in 4% under budget. No headcount additions requested. Approval needed by the 15th to hold supplier pricing. Risks: Ostermill lead times and one unresolved licensing dispute. Finance has signed off on the cash position. The confidential rationale for this request appears below.

board note of tawip-hahip: Only 7 of the 80 pilot accounts renewed Ralath, so a churn review is set for April 1.